Hyderabad police seize adulterated oil and repackaged flour in Gachibowli

Hyderabad's Madhapur Special Operations Team raided two locations and seized over 5,000 litres of adulterated cooking oil along with 5,000 kg of wheat flour. The accused are a father-son duo from Rajasthan. The operation took place on March 9, 2026.

A report published on Tuesday, March 10, 2026, details how Hyderabad police's Madhapur Special Operations Team (SOT) conducted raids at two locations in the city on Monday. The operations resulted in the seizure of thousands of litres of adulterated cooking oil and wheat flour.

The accused individuals are 46-year-old Bhanwar Ram and his 22-year-old son Ashok Kumar, both natives of Rajasthan. According to police, the father-son duo had been running an adulteration racket from various premises in NTR Nagar and Vattinagulapally in Gachibowli. The adulterated oil consisted of expired cooking oil mixed with soybean oil. Additionally, expired wheat flour was being repackaged for sale.

This incident highlights food adulteration concerns in Hyderabad, where authorities have seized the materials and initiated further investigations.
